Transaction 232576e94d4a4ceb94bbf1071eb8629fde0841c4d9dc33f965d90942360fbd24
1 Input
2 Outputs
- 232576e94d4a4ceb94bbf1071eb8629fde0841c4d9dc33f965d90942360fbd24:0
- 232576e94d4a4ceb94bbf1071eb8629fde0841c4d9dc33f965d90942360fbd24:1
value 3344640
address 3EfmsqvRx9bXT5kb7ZfqH3AMdZ9jabnC2t
value 5102739
address 1ayWCLNtfbX5cPccSH19rXE9D9ekgD4AF